Good American is hiring an Influencer Marketing Coordinator to join their Los Angeles team. Reporting to the Sr. Influencer Marketing Manager, this role will be responsible for assisting in all task related to influencer marketing.

Responsibilities:

· Create and coordinate content with social influencers for paid and unpaid influencer marketing programs across various channels.

· Identify on brand talent and establish authentic goal driven influencer relationships.

· Effectively take projects from concept to completion using great project management tools and follow through.

· Develop content ideas, attend events as needed, and liaise with marketing team to coordinate marketing strategies across various channels.

· Drive brand awareness via social media.

· Increase Instagram followers specific to market.

· Drive traffic to site.

· Day-to-day management of influencer marketing activities in the US.

· Execute campaigns.

· Contact and build new relationships with influencers and agencies

· Work on reporting and analytics.

· Use social listening tools to find new opportunities for growth.

· Be responsible for social content creation at all key events.

· Work with the internal teams to repurpose UGC across channels.

· Support digital team with delivering creative assets for social advertising campaign.

· Does not want to be an influencer.

Professional skills, experience and attributes:

· 1-2 years of experience or relevant internships, and fluency in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, and Snapchat

· Experience working with identifying influencers is preferred.

· Experience with contemporary or denim brands or relevant businesses is a plus

· Exceptional written and oral communication skills.

· Strong organizational skills and attention to detail and accuracy.

· Excellent at working and delivering against deadlines and the ability to work under pressure.

· Proficiency in Microsoft Office

· BA/BS degree preferred.
